Choosing the right placement

Placement height is critical for wall lights. For bedside use, mount the fixture at approximately 140–160cm from the floor, so the centre of the light is roughly at eye level when seated. This ensures comfortable reading light without glare. In hallways, aim for 150–170cm to provide good ambient coverage without the light being too low or too high. For flanking mirrors, artwork, or architectural features, centre the fixture at eye level or slightly above, depending on the scale of the feature.

Consider the surrounding décor and wall colour when planning placement. Light-coloured walls will reflect and amplify the warm glow, whilst darker walls will absorb some of the light, creating a more intimate, cocooning effect. If you're using multiple fixtures, ensure consistent spacing and alignment for a polished, professional look. Measure carefully and use a spirit level during installation to avoid wonky results.

When selecting a bulb, consider both brightness and colour temperature. Warm white is usually the safest choice for bedrooms, living rooms, restaurants and hotel-style interiors because it creates a softer atmosphere. Brighter or cooler light may be more suitable for task-focused areas, but can feel harsh if used as the only light source in a room.

How should I clean and care for Natural Wood and Stained Glass Wall Lamp?

For everyday care, gently wipe Natural Wood and Stained Glass Wall Lamp with a soft, dry cotton cloth. Avoid household detergents, abrasive cleaners, alcohol-based sprays or rough cloths, as these can affect the finish over time.

Before cleaning, switch the light off and allow it to cool fully. For glass, painted or plated surfaces, use light pressure only. Good maintenance should be almost invisible: regular dusting is usually enough to keep the piece looking quietly exceptional for years.

In hospitality or commercial interiors, include the fixture in a regular maintenance routine so dust does not build up around visible edges, shades or fittings. Avoid over-cleaning with strong products; gentle, consistent care is usually better for preserving the finish.
